This book was compiled to give heart felt messages to encourage, inspire and empower a new generation of young women. After the murder of Clark Atlanta University student Alexis Crawford, at the hands of her roommate and her roommate's boyfriend, the authors felt compelled to share their stories of faith, perseverance and the ability to overcome all situations in hopes that young women would know that any trial could be turned into a triumph. It covers various topics such as faith, love, abuse, marriage, divorce, death, molestation and a host of other issues. These issues however did not hold these women hostage. Their strong faith and determination to press forward enable the authors to overcome and succeed in life, love and careers. The authors are comprise of a diverse group of women who are/were a part of a membership organization of mothers with children between the ages 2-19.
